In a suo motu ruling, the Central Electricity Regulatory Commission (CERC) said monthly tariffs must be revised-or refunds issued-to reflect the GST rate cut to 5% from 12%. The directive, industry executives said, raises the bar on internal systems, audit trails and disclosures for both developers and discoms, aiming to curb disputes and enforce greater discipline in documentation.
